A longtime favorite of
locals and visitors alike, the Flying Fish Grill is small and
intimate and filled with mouth-watering aromas. There's a
cozy, Japanese feel to the decor with vividly colorful flying
fish created by Kenny in papier-mache that float from the
ceiling and artwork by local artists that add to the visual
pleasure. You may be greeted at the door by Tina, Kenny's
wife, or by Kenny himself, who spends time checking on the
guests when he's not in the kitchen.
The Flying fish Grill is about
family, loyalty, conviviality and loving what you do. Delicious food
is only one of the attractions. |
